Oakwood readies new Melbourne development

Oakwood, a wholly owned subsidiary of Mapletree Investments, is expanding into Australia's luxury hotel and serviced apartments segment with the signing of Oakwood Premier Melbourne, slated to open in Q1 2022 in the city's Southbank district.

The complex will be part of a new-build, 40-story tower in the Fishermans Bend development, and will have a total of 392 accommodations: 154 guestrooms and 238 studio, one- and two-bedroom serviced apartments. 

Proposed facilities within Oakwood Premier Melbourne include an all-day dining restaurant, meeting venues, a lobby bar and fitness center, as well as retail spaces. Sky Bar Melbourne will offer city views.

Located along the southern banks of the Yarra River, Oakwood Premier Melbourne will be close to several corporate office buildings and key international and regional financial institutions, as well as the Melbourne Convention Centre. 

Oakwood was tapped by Yarra Hotel Group (through its advisory firm Prime Square) to operate the complex. The signing follows the recent announcement of Oakwood Hotel & Apartments Dandenong in April.
